A Study on Environmentally Aware Business Models Lean, Green, Zero Waste Technology, and Corporate Social Responsibility
P. Latha [3] | Inbasekaran S
Abstract: Population growth and Industrialization has resulted in global warming. This paper explores a framework of new business model such as Lean, Green Manufactur- ing and Zero waste technologies for the tanning sector. Green and Lean Manufacturing systems help to mini- mize environmental impact of manufacturing processes and products. An integrated Lean and Green manufac- turing system model, zero waste manufacturing is pro- posed as a solution for economically and environmen- tally sustainable manufacturing. The outcome of lean model results in reduced inventory levels, decreased material usage, optimized equipment, reduced need for factory facilities, increased production velocity, en- hanced production flexibility, eliminating waste throughout the production process, employee involve- ment, supply chain investment and so forth. A green manufacturing system consists of an Environ- mental management system that defines the corporate environmental policies and procedures such as ISO 14001, waste reducing techniques and results. It is re- ported that Lean manufacturing substantially reduces the facility footprint of production. Lean - Green Technology, Supply Chain Management, Chemical Leasing, Value Stream Mapping
